Convenient transfer printing machine for doll toys
By designing a lifting mechanism and auxiliary mechanism for a convenient pad printing machine for doll toys, the problem of inconvenient replacement of pad printing heads in pad printing machines has been solved, improving the efficiency and ease of operation of pad printing machines.

TECHNICAL FIELD
[0001] The utility model relates to a pad printing machine technical field, concretely relates to a convenient pad printing machine for doll toys. BACKGROUND
[0002] The pad printing machine is a kind of printing equipment, is through the adhesive printing pattern of deformable rubber head, and the printing equipment for printing product, is widely used in printing processing of plastic, toy, glass, metal, ceramic and electronic, when using pad printing machine, rubber head sticks ink each time, and the risk of ink splashing is produced, leading to ink pollution on-site processing environment, simultaneously, the height of rubber head cannot be adjusted, and it brings trouble for printing product of different height and thickness.
[0003] Through the search, prior art CN209999852U discloses a pad printing machine with ink anti-splashing function, including fixed box body, the side outer surface of fixed box body is provided with power socket, the front surface of fixed box body is fixedly installed with control panel, the upper surface of fixed box body is fixedly installed with fixed table, the upper surface of fixed table is fixedly installed with mounting plate, the upper surface of mounting plate is provided with ink cup magnetic attraction fixing ring, the upper surface of ink cup magnetic attraction fixing ring is detachably installed with pad printing ink cup, the upper surface of pad printing ink cup is fixedly installed with anti-splashing sleeve ring, the inner side of anti-splashing sleeve ring is fixedly installed with ink brush hair.The pad printing machine with ink anti-splashing function disclosed by the utility model can brush off the excess ink adhered to the pad printing rubber head, prevent ink splashing from polluting the on-site environment, and adjust the fixed height of the pad printing rubber head to facilitate printing of products of different heights and thicknesses.
[0004] But the above-mentioned equipment has the following problems when using: since pad printing rubber head is fixedly installed with pad printing machine in use, which makes pad printing rubber head need to be closed when replacing pad printing machine, not only inconvenient to replace, but also affects the production efficiency of pad printing machine, so that pad printing machine is inconvenient to replace pad printing rubber head in use, reduces the use effect of pad printing machine. UTILITY MODEL CONTENTS
[0005] The utility model aims at providing a convenient pad printing machine for doll toys to solve the problem of inconvenient replacement of pad printing rubber head in use of existing pad printing machine and reduce the use effect of pad printing machine.
[0006] To achieve the above-mentioned purpose, the utility model adopts the following technical scheme: the utility model provides a convenient pad printing machine for doll toys, including pad printing machine body, the both sides of pad printing machine body are provided with lift mechanism, and the top is detachably installed with placing table, and it further includes auxiliary mechanism.
[0007] The auxiliary mechanism comprises an adjusting plate, a positioning sliding seat, a limiting nut, a support, a moving plate, a supporting seat, a limiting seat, a mounting plate, a printing device, a descending device and a limiting device, the adjusting plate is detachably connected with the pad printer body and located at the rear side of the placing table, the T-shaped sliding part at the bottom of the positioning sliding seat can linearly slide in the T-shaped sliding groove of the adjusting plate, the limiting nut is threadedly connected with the outer threaded rod at the top of the positioning sliding seat and abuts against the adjusting plate, the support is integrally formed with the positioning sliding seat and located on the positioning sliding seat, the moving plate is detachably connected with the support and located at the front side of the support, the supporting seat is detachably connected with the support and the moving plate respectively, semicircular clamping blocks are arranged at the inner bottom of the supporting seat on both sides respectively, the limiting seat is installed on the top of the supporting seat through a T-shaped pin and a split pin and semicircular clamping blocks are arranged at the bottom on both sides, the printing device is arranged below the mounting plate, the mounting plate is arranged below the moving plate and can move vertically through the action of the descending device, and the limiting device is arranged on both sides of the pad printer body and close to the adjusting plate.
[0008] The printing device comprises a connecting seat and a pad printing rubber head, the connecting seat is integrally formed with the mounting plate and located at the bottom front side of the mounting plate, and the top mounting part of the pad printing rubber head is screw-connected and installed at the bottom of the connecting seat.
[0009] The descending device comprises an electric push rod and a guide assembly, the electric push rod is fixedly connected with the moving plate and electrically connected with the pad printer body, and the output end of the electric push rod is connected with the mounting plate through a countersunk bolt, and the guide assembly is arranged on the side of the mounting plate close to the moving plate.
[0010] The limiting device comprises a left limiting plate and a right limiting plate, the left limiting plate is detachably connected with the pad printer body and located at the top left rear side of the pad printer body, and the right limiting plate is detachably connected with the pad printer body and located at the top right rear side of the pad printer body.
[0011] The doll toy convenient pad printer further comprises a stabilizing mechanism, the stabilizing mechanism comprises a positioning plate and positioning bolts, the positioning plate is arranged between the support and the limiting nut and fixed through the positioning bolts, and the number of the positioning bolts is three and they are threadedly connected with the adjusting plate and the positioning sliding seat respectively.
[0012] The utility model discloses a doll toy convenient pad printing machine, when replacing the pad printing rubber head, first loosen the limit nut, then slide to the left side and push the positioning slide seat to the leftmost side, further tighten the limit nut, through the operation can directly move the printing device to the left side of equipment, thereby when replacing, the printing device bottom has greater operating space compared with when replacing on the upper side of the placement table, and it is more beneficial to realize the convenient replacement of parts, after replacing, loosen the limit nut, move the printing device to the fixed point again and fix, finally can carry out the printing work, and then can solve the problem that the existing pad printing machine is inconvenient to replace the pad printing rubber head in use, reduces the use effect of pad printing machine. DETAILED DESCRIPTION
[0020] In order to make the technical personnel in the art can better understand the utility model, the utility model technical scheme is further explained below in connection with the drawings and examples.
[0021] Example one:
[0022] As Figures 1 to 3 Indicated, wherein Figure 1It is the overall structure schematic diagram of the figurine toy convenient pad printing machine, Figure 2 It is the structure schematic diagram of the adjusting plate 104, Figure 3 It is the structure schematic diagram of the limiting seat 110, the utility model provides a kind of figurine toy convenient pad printing machine: including pad printing machine body 101, lift mechanism 102, placement table 103 and auxiliary mechanism, the auxiliary mechanism includes adjusting plate 104, positioning slide base 105, limiting nut 106, support 107, moving plate 108, support seat 109, limiting seat 110, mounting plate 111, printing device, descending device and limiting device, the printing device includes connecting seat 112 and pad printing rubber head 113, the descending device includes electric push rod 114 and guide assembly 115, the limiting device includes left limiting plate 116 and right limiting plate 117.It can solve the problem that the prior pad printing machine is inconvenient to replace pad printing rubber head 113 in use, reduces the use effect of pad printing machine by the foregoing scheme, it can be understood that the foregoing scheme can facilitate the convenient replacement of pad printing rubber head 113.
[0023] In the embodiment, the pad printing machine body 101 is provided with lift mechanism 102 on both sides, and the placement table 103 is detachably installed on the top, the lift mechanism 102 is composed of detachable supporting ears and rotatable brackets, which is beneficial to the movement of the equipment, and the placement table 103 is used for placing toys during printing, in the application, the pad printing rubber head 113 is matched with the corresponding ink cartridge in advance by the operator before printing, so that the printed pattern can be on the outer surface of the pad printing rubber head 113, and the placement table 103 can be fixed by means of countersunk head bolts.
[0024] The adjusting plate 104 is detachably connected with the pad printer body 101 and located at the rear side of the placing table 103; the T-shaped sliding part at the bottom of the positioning sliding seat 105 can linearly slide in the T-shaped sliding groove of the adjusting plate 104; the limiting nut 106 is threadedly connected with the outer threaded rod at the top of the positioning sliding seat 105 and abuts against the adjusting plate 104; the support 107 is integrally formed with the positioning sliding seat 105 and located on the positioning sliding seat 105; the moving plate 108 is detachably connected with the support 107 and located at the front side of the support 107; the support seat 109 is detachably connected with the support 107 and the moving plate 108; the semicircular clamping blocks are arranged at the inner bottom of the support seat 109 on both sides; the limiting seat 110 is installed on the top of the support seat 109 through a T-shaped pin and a split pin and is provided with the matching semicircular clamping blocks at the bottom on both sides; the printing device is arranged below the mounting plate 111; the mounting plate 111 is arranged below the moving plate 108 and can move vertically through the action of the downward device; the limiting device is arranged on both sides of the pad printer body 101 and close to the adjusting plate 104. A plurality of countersunk head bolts are arranged at the inner bottom of the T-shaped sliding groove of the adjusting plate 104 in a linear interval, so as to be fixed through the bolts; the T-shaped sliding part at the bottom of the positioning sliding seat 105 can linearly slide in the T-shaped sliding groove; the limiting nut 106 can be directly installed on the outer screw rod at the top of the positioning sliding seat 105; the moving plate 108 is fixed on the support 107 through the positioning pin and the bolt tensioning; the mounting plate 111 is arranged at the bottom of the front side of the moving plate 108; the support seat 109 is fixed through the bolts at the rear side and the front side mounting end part; the bolts at the front side end part are arranged from bottom to top; the semicircular clamping blocks are arranged at the inner bottom of the support seat 109 on both sides, so as to be clamped by the working cables; the limiting seat 110 is slidingly installed at the top cavity of the support seat 109, penetrates the T-shaped pin and finally penetrates the split pin on the T-shaped pin to be limited; the end parts at the bottom on both sides of the limiting seat 110 are provided with the matching clamping blocks for the cable arrangement; the support seat 109 and the limiting seat 110 are used for protecting the working cables of the downward device; since the cables are fixedly arranged at the rear side, the length of the cables is avoided from being too long to fall on the toys during the pad printing; however, the connection part between the cables and the pad printer body 101 is arranged as a certain length of movable structure, which avoids the cables from being broken when the positioning sliding seat 105 moves; the printing device is used for printing; the downward device is used for driving the downward movement of the printing device; and the limiting device is used for working limiting.
[0025] Secondly, the connecting seat 112 is integrally formed with the mounting plate 111 and located at the bottom front side of the mounting plate 111; and the top mounting part of the pad printing rubber head 113 is threadedly installed at the bottom of the connecting seat 112. The connecting seat 112 is vertically downwardly provided with a connecting threaded hole, so as to facilitate the installation of the outer threaded end part at the top of the pad printing rubber head 113.
[0026] Then, the electric push rod 114 is fixedly connected with the moving plate 108 and electrically connected with the pad printer body 101, and the output end thereof is connected with the mounting plate 111 through a countersunk bolt; the guide assembly 115 is arranged on the side of the mounting plate 111 close to the moving plate 108. The electric push rod 114 is fixed through a bolt, the cable thereof is partially fixed through cooperation of the support seat 109 and the limiting seat 110, and then the rear side of the fixed part and the pad printer body 101 are arranged as a movable part, so as to avoid breakage during movement; the output end of the electric push rod 114 is connected with the mounting plate 111 through a bolt; the guide assembly 115 comprises a guide rod and a T-shaped sliding sleeve, the T-shaped sliding sleeve is mounted on the moving plate 108 and is in sliding cooperation with the guide rod, and the outer threaded end of the bottom of the guide rod is directly connected with the threaded connecting hole on the mounting plate 111.
[0027] Finally, the left limiting plate 116 is detachably connected with the pad printer body 101 and is located at the top left rear side of the pad printer body 101; the right limiting plate 117 is detachably connected with the pad printer body 101 and is located at the top right rear side of the pad printer body 101. The left limiting plate 116 and the right limiting plate 117 are consistent in size and are both fixed through bolts, and the function is to limit the positioning sliding seat 105.
[0028] When the pad printer is used to solve the problem that the existing pad printer is inconvenient to replace the pad printing head 113 during use and reduces the use effect of the pad printer, when the pad printing head 113 is replaced, firstly, the limiting nut 106 is loosened, then the positioning sliding seat 105 is slid to the left side to the leftmost side, the limiting nut 106 is further tightened, through the operation, the printing device can be directly moved to the left side of the equipment, so that the bottom of the printing device has a larger operation space when being replaced than when being replaced above the placing table 103, and the replacement of parts is more convenient, after the replacement is completed, the limiting nut 106 is loosened, the printing device is moved to the fixing point again for fixing, and finally the printing work can be carried out. When positioning, the adjusting plate 104 is provided with a positioning strip which is aligned with the left side edge of the positioning sliding seat 105, so as to facilitate alignment. When printing, the operator cooperates the corresponding ink box with the pad printing head 113 in advance, so that the printed pattern can be on the outer surface of the pad printing head 113, then the ink box is removed, the toy is further placed on the placing table 103 at the corresponding position, finally, the control panel on the front side of the pad printer body 101 is controlled to drive the electric push rod 114 to act, and then the pad printing head 113 can be printed after descending, thereby solving the problem that the existing pad printer is inconvenient to replace the pad printing head 113 during use and reduces the use effect of the pad printer.
